From: Koumine enhances spinal cord 3α-hydroxysteroid oxidoreductase expression and activity in a rat model of neuropathic pain

Fig. 5

The effect of koumine on -hydroxysteroid oxidoreductase mRNA expression in the spinal cord of sciatic nerve chronic constriction injury rats. The -hydroxysteroid oxidoreductase (-HSOR) mRNA level is expressed as the ratio of gl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ate dehydrogenase (GAPDH) mRNA in the spinal cord (SC) of naïve, sham-operated, sciatic nerve chronic constriction injury (CCI), or koumine-treated rats. The data are presented as the mean ± SEM (n = 6 per group) and were analyzed by two-way ANOVA followed by Bonferroni post hoc test at each time point. ## P < 0.01 vs. the sham group; *P < 0.05 vs. the CCI group.
